Output 7508c2620b2fd0fa31a4101cce26b3afbc6b1c5f7e462565fdaecd554180611a:1

value
161769
script pubkey
OP_0 OP_PUSHBYTES_20 b4a0d45bf84e11b8fef7cc313c7d50327a1a0d6a
address
bc1qkjsdgklcfcgm3lhhescncl2sxfap5rt2alqcp3
transaction
7508c2620b2fd0fa31a4101cce26b3afbc6b1c5f7e462565fdaecd554180611a
confirmations
39836
spent
true